Transaction 007912b51c361304ad4d6dff48cf497dd3cc100c77c0bfbb7e508f30dc233cea

block
4a4d74876fe05177e8d3bd7ddbf6828e06ee318f6afb98b7e2c4a76d50281993

1 Input

23 Outputs